New Legislation to Ban Credit Gambling The Swedish government has proposed new legislation aimed at curbing gambling-related debt by prohibiting gambling funded by credit. This initiative, titled “A New Ban on Credit Gambling,” seeks to broaden existing limitations under the national Gambling Act and is planned to be implemented by April 1, 2026. Current Rules […]

Withdrawal of Legal Opinion Challenges Alaska Tribal Gaming The U.S. Department of the Interior has retracted a crucial legal interpretation that previously enabled Alaska tribes to operate casino-style gaming facilities. This development casts doubt on the viability of two recently launched tribal gaming projects. Impact on Eklutna and Tlingit-Haida Casino Initiatives On September 25, Deputy […]
